"We were supposed to leave on September 7 but the PIA flight on that day has been cancelled. Hence, we would be leaving on September 11," Riaz Akram Cheema, part of the legal team defending the seven Pakistani suspects, told PTI.
The anti-terrorism court in Islamabad hearing the Mumbai attacks case will be informed about the development tomorrow, he said.
"The window that had been given to us (for the visit) was between September 3 and 18," Cheema said.
Special Prosecutor M Azhar Chaudhry informed the judge that the gazette notification would be submitted in court tomorrow.
Cheema told the court that the panel needs at least four days to cross-examine four witnesses in Mumbai. Judge Atiqur Rehman then adjourned the hearing till tomorrow.
The judge had on September 1 directed the prosecution to get a gazette notification issued about the commission's visit before today's hearing.
The witnesses are the magistrate who recorded LeT member Ajmal Kasab's confessional statement, the chief investigating officer and two doctors who conducted the autopsy of the terrorists who carried out the Mumbai attacks in November 2008.
This will be the panel's second visit to India. A report submitted by the panel after its first visit in March 2012 was rejected by an anti-terrorism court as the commission's members were not allowed to cross-examine witnesses.
